Umekita Park
Park
4.4
Discover a stunning free hydrangea garden in the heart of Osaka, perfect for a peaceful escape. Visit during the rainy season for vibrant blooms and a refreshing atmosphere. Enjoy a quiet moment amidst nature, surrounded by the city's modern architecture.

Café Kitsuné Osaka
Cafe
3.7
Sip on refreshing lemonades or yuzu lemonades, complemented by adorable fox cookies, in a serene garden setting. This cafe offers a charming outdoor experience, perfect for a break amidst vibrant hydrangeas. It’s an ideal spot to enjoy unique drinks and sweets with a picturesque backdrop.

FUKU-NO-TANE
Dessert shop
4.1
Savor beautifully crafted seasonal wagashi, traditional Japanese sweets that are a feast for both the eyes and the palate. Their artistic confections are perfect for experiencing authentic Japanese culinary artistry. A delightful stop for those seeking unique and culturally rich dessert experiences.
